Research Innovations are at the core of what NCI does. They pour resources into discovering new ways to diagnose and treat cancer. This includes developing **precision medicine** approaches, where treatments are tailored specifically to individual patients based on their genetic makeup. Imagine being able to fight your cancer with drugs that know just how to target those pesky cells!

Another cool area they focus on is **immunotherapy**. This is like giving your immune system a pep talk so it can recognize and attack cancer cells more effectively. Researchers are constantly working on improving these therapies, making them available for more types of cancers, which could really change the way we fight this disease.

Then there’s the whole realm of **prevention and early detection**. NCI prioritizes understanding risk factors that contribute to cancer. They’re looking into things like lifestyle habits, environmental influences, and genetic predispositions—basically figuring out why some people get cancer and others don’t. By identifying these factors, they can craft better strategies for prevention.

In terms of public health initiatives, the NCI is all about getting information out there to help communities make informed choices about their health. They work with a variety of organizations to improve access to screenings and raise awareness about healthy behaviors that can reduce cancer risk.

Another aspect worth mentioning is their commitment to **diversity in research**, which means ensuring that studies include participants from different backgrounds. This helps scientists understand how various populations might respond differently to treatments or be affected by certain cancers.

One of the big areas right now is immunotherapy. Basically, instead of just attacking cancer cells directly (like traditional treatments), immunotherapy helps your own immune system recognize and fight the cancer. It’s kind of like training your body to be a superhero against the bad guys! For instance, checkpoint inhibitors are drugs that release the brakes on your immune system, allowing it to go full throttle against tumors.

There’s also something called CAR-T cell therapy. This is where doctors take a patient’s T-cells (a type of immune cell) and modify them in a lab so they can better recognize and attack cancer cells. After this customization, they put those cells back into the patient. It’s like giving your immune system a high-tech upgrade!

Now, let’s talk about liquid biopsies, which are pretty rad. Instead of doing invasive procedures to get tissue samples from tumors, liquid biopsies analyze blood samples to find markers or DNA from cancer cells. This way, you can catch changes in tumors without major surgeries. It’s less painful and can give real-time insights into how well treatment is working.
